Is sort by "Active" using the wrong methodology?

submitted by

If you go here: https://piefed.social/home/active/all

It just looks like its showing the most recently commented post. That probably isn’t how “Active” is suppose to work. On Lemmy, it works like this: https://join-lemmy.org/docs/users/03-votes-and-ranking.html

Active (default): Calculates a rank based on the score and time of the latest comment, with decay over time
